About Espn Ringside Muhammad Ali
He's still the most recognizable man in the ring; a poet, a dancer, a fast talker with a fist full of knock-outs for any whom dared to challenge the Greatest . Three-time Heavyweight Champion of the world, he is dubbed Athlete of the Century by GQ magazine, Sports Illustrated's & Sportsman of the Century, and in 2005, he even received the United States of America's highest civil award, the Presidential Medal of Freedom. As a boxer, Ali brought speed, grace, and unconventional technique; outside of the ring he charmed the world. Ringside Ali brings complete, unheard-of full-fight coverage, with 12 hours of legendary footage including: Liston, Foreman, Frazier, and the dethroning of Leon Spinks to become heavyweight champion for an unprecedented third time. but this is now officially the big dog of them all weighing in at nearly 10 hours of content. This I believe was shown on ESPN. They have commentators talking about each fight and so we don't just have a long line of boxing footage but we also have the press conferences around the fights just wonderful footage for a fan of ALI like myself. The bonus (4th) DVD ,3 plus hours itself!, concentrates on the relationship of ALI and Howard Cosell and ABC's Wide World Of Sports...and alone is a gem worth the price of this set. Its really a single source treasure trove of ALI footage and it all is looking as good as I've ever seen it. Aside from the classic fights we've seen over and over...Liston,Frazier,Foreman...we get many other early fights and later ones..15 fights in total!
the only thing NOT first class is the idiotic container..they've stacked ALL 4 DVDs on top of each other on a single post...which is just asking for trouble and really cheap ...considering the price of this set really tacky.
